Application

• Reactant for enantioselective synthesis of indoles via palladium-catalyzed kinetic asymmetrical alkylation1
• Reactant for preparation of N-pyridinyl indolecarboxamides via amidation of aminopyridine derivatives. with indolecarboxylic acid2
• Reactant for preparation of mast cell tryptase inhibitors, starting from indoles; using amidation as the key step3
• Reactant for formation of Michael adducts via Baylis-Hillman reaction4
• Reactant for preparation of indolecarboxamides via haloform cleavage of (trifluoroacetyl)indole with lithium dialkylamides5
